The problematic issues of the methodology for the assessment of immunological efficiency (efficacy) of plague live vaccine (PLV) are noted. The current tasks and possible prospects for the introduction of immunological monitoring of persons vaccinated against plague upon epidemic indications have been defined. The algorithm of efficacy estimation of plague live vaccine in vaccinated (revaccinated) persons has been tested under real conditions. Analysis of the results of efficacy evaluation of plague live vaccine among vaccinated (revaccinated) people against plague living in the territories of natural foci of this infection has been performed. Demonstrated is the possibility of using immunological monitoring results in creating an objective basis for improving the strategy of specific plague prevention in natural foci of this infection. The priority areas for further optimization of the specific plague prevention in the territories of natural foci of the infection, including those related to the formation of individual regimen revaccination tactics, taking into account the possibilities of creating modern and effective vaccines, are outlined.</p><p> </p></trans-abstract><kwd-group xml:lang="ru"><kwd>иммунологический мониторинг</kwd><kwd>вакцина живая чумная</kwd><kwd>эпидемиологический надзор</kwd></kwd-group><kwd-group xml:lang="en"><kwd>immunological monitoring</kwd><kwd>live plague vaccine</kwd><kwd>epidemiological surveillance</kwd></kwd-group></article-meta></front><back><ref-list><title>References</title><ref id="cit1"><label>1</label><citation-alternatives><mixed-citation xml:lang="ru">Балахонов С.В., Попова А.Ю., Мищенко А.И., Михайлов Е.П., Ежлова Е.Б., Демина Ю.В., Денисова А.В., Рождественский Е.Н., Базарова Г.Х., Щучинов Л.В., Зарубин И.В., Семенова Ж.Е., Маденова Н.М., Дюсенбаев Д.К., Ярыгина Г.Х., Чипанин Е.В., Косилко С.А., Носков А.К., Корзун В.М.
